Script Amnug 10 is a light, very narrow, very high contrast, italic, short x-height font.

This script shows a calligraphic, forward-leaning construction with hairline entry/exit strokes and pronounced thick–thin modulation. Stems are slender and elongated, with narrow letterforms and frequent loops on ascenders and descenders that create a lively vertical rhythm. Terminals often taper into fine, curving flicks, and several capitals feature decorative cross-strokes and swashed beginnings that feel pen-driven rather than geometric. Spacing is tight and flowing, with a generally connected texture in words and occasional open joins that keep counters airy.
Best suited to display settings where its fine hairlines and flourished capitals can be appreciated: wedding suites, event stationery, beauty and fashion branding, product packaging, and short headline or logo work. It also works well for pull quotes or hero text when paired with a restrained companion for body copy.
The overall tone is graceful and polished, suggesting a boutique, editorial sensibility. Its looping forms and delicate hairlines give it a romantic, celebratory voice that reads as personal and upscale rather than casual. The dramatic contrast and tall proportions add a touch of theatrical flair suited to statement typography.
The design appears intended to emulate formal pen script with a refined, editorial finish—prioritizing expressive capitals, elegant contrast, and a flowing word shape for high-impact, decorative typography.
Capitals are especially expressive and can dominate the line, while the lowercase maintains a consistent slanted rhythm with long extenders that add motion. Numerals follow the same calligraphic logic, with slender silhouettes and occasional flourished curves that match the letterforms.
